Builder profile
Ferretti
Founded in Forlì in 1968, Ferretti Yachts has defined the Italian flybridge cruiser for over five decades. Each vessel pairs balanced naval architecture by Filippo Salvetti with interiors curated to feel like a private villa at sea — generous volumes, panoramic glass, and a sea-kindly displacement hull engineered for offshore comfort.
- Pioneers of the modern flybridge cruiser
- Continuous evolution of the Vector Hull naval architecture
- Bespoke interiors hand-finished in Cattolica
Location intelligence
Côte d'Azur
The Côte d'Azur runs from the Italian border at Menton to the Côte Vermeille — but the yachting capital is the 60-mile strip from Monaco through Antibes to Saint-Tropez. Port Hercule hosts Monaco Yacht Show; Antibes' IYCA is home to half of the Mediterranean's superyacht crew. From Cannes, you can be in the Lérins islands by lunch, the Esterel red-rock coast by mid-afternoon, and back at the Carlton dock by aperitivo. The water is warmer than Sardinia in June but cooler than Sicily in September — making the Riviera a 5-month workable season.
- Monaco berths book 12+ months in advance for Grand Prix week and YachtShow week.
- Antibes Port Vauban remains the best-value mid-superyacht (25–40m) home port on the coast.
- Mistral can blow hard at Saint-Tropez; the protected anchorage at Pampelonne is the work-around.

What does a Ferretti typically cost?
Ferretti pricing varies by year and length: yachts in the 12–18 metre range generally sit between €150,000 and €600,000 for pre-owned hulls, while larger flagships exceed €1M. NewSail provides a current valuation for any specific Ferretti on request, grounded in completed comparable sales — not asking prices.
Do you handle the Italian registration / VAT paperwork?
Yes. We work with maritime lawyers in Italy, France and Spain to handle the Memorandum of Agreement, VAT positioning, flag choice (Italian, Maltese, French) and registration. Closing typically takes four to eight weeks from accepted offer to keys in hand.
